    Keyboard layout bugs

    Hi,
    I have a really odd problem:
    I use Ubuntu Intrepid Ibex, and I tried to change my keyboard layout via system-settings-keyboard. It is currently set to Germany eliminate dead keys.
    Now when I change the layout to one in a language other to German, the following happens:
    I open up a new xterm window and type in a few characters to test the layout. What I get when i type asdf is æßðđ, that is the 3rd characters for those keys (I'm not holding Alt Gr). When I change the layout back, I get my working German layout again.
    Do you have any idea how that happens, and what to do about it?

    Re: Keyboard layout bugs

    For some reason it's working again, don't ask my how.
    I removed my custom .Xmodmap, loaded a keyboard layout, put my Xmodmap back and loaded the layout i wanted, and it worked.
